Color, Fit, and Material: The Style Coach Lens

Unique items fail if they combat your coloring or percentages. I do color analysis in Chicago under neutral light due to the fact that shop lights exists. The objective isn't to catch you in a "season," yet to map touches and comparison level. If your skin reads cool with reduced contrast, a deep teal or forest might be your brand-new black. Warm, high-contrast customers usually glow in rust, camel, or cream color with sharp navy. When you go shopping stores with restricted size runs, recognizing your finest color array allows you attack when a unicorn appears.

Fit is physics. A long rise can rescue a brief torso. A a little gone down shoulder can relax a framework without slumping over. On customized pieces, I favor seams you can blurt at the very least a fifty percent inch. It's insurance policy. For knitwear, I inspect recuperation by gently stretching a cuff and enjoying it break back. With jeans, I opt for 98 percent cotton with 2 percent elastane for structure and convenience, and I prevent ultra-stretch that bags by lunch. A wardrobe consultant in Chicago ought to be proficient in these information. Our task is to equate them right into clothes that feel like you.

When to Get, When to Wait

Impulse can be the opponent in a boutique city. I instruct customers a two-minute fit and feature examination. If a garment passes, we take a quick photo and march for coffee. If you can't quit thinking of it by the time the espresso is gone, we return. If you've forgotten it, that addresses the concern. Heavy players like coats, sports jackets, boots, and bags gain the right to be purchased quickly when they solve a recognized issue. Seasonal novelties must pass the psychological coffee test.

Here's a small decision filter I make use of mid-appointment:

  • Does it harmonize with at the very least three existing items I own?
  • Will I wear it at least once a week for the next 2 months, or as soon as a month for the following year?
  • Does the textile and building match the price?
  • Can it be become ideal, and do I have a dressmaker lined up?
  • Does it strengthen my individual brand, not simply fill a hanger?

Alterations: The Undetected Advantage

An off-the-rack garment becomes yours at the dressmaker. I arrange pinning consultations the exact same day we buy ideally. Regular tweaks: hem and sleeve size, waist nip, back seam clean-up, and shoulder slope adjustments. For weaved outfits, side joints can improve shape without distortion if the tailor supports the joint. With denim, I typically have the waist absorbed by the yoke as opposed hire a style coach Chicago to the side joint to protect pocket placement.

Care, Storage space, and Weather Condition Reality

Chicago weather examinations clothing. I choose textiles that endure salt, slush, and swift temperature adjustments. For outerwear, tightly woven wool or technical blends defeat loose knits when wind cuts off the lake. I treat natural leather boots before the very first snow and keep cedar footwear trees to dry and maintain form. Scarves, hats, and gloves get a shade strategy also, so wintertime appearances are purposeful, not haphazard.

At home, I keep knits folded up, maintain match coats on large wall mounts, and rotate garments so take on anxiety does not create ridges. A seasonal wardrobe audit assists catch moth activity or textile tiredness before it develops into loss. These little behaviors extend the life of boutique-quality pieces.

Budgeting and Worth: Making the Mix Work

A healthy closet balances investment and worth pieces. I usually allot 60 percent of a period's budget plan to anchors: coats, boots, blazers, bags. The remaining 40 percent covers meaningful products and refresher courses: tops, skirts, denim, and devices. Sales can aid, however I never ever allowed price override fit and utility. A half-price coat that lives in a garment bag sets you back greater than a full-price jacket you wear twice a week.

Clients that go shopping quarterly as opposed to responding monthly often tend to spend much less and clothe better. We set styles per quarter such as customizing update, knitwear refresh, spring shoes. That technique leaves area for luck, the heart of one-of-a-kind finds.
